The report assumes that the demand for contracted termite control services has grown rapidly in recent years compared to the decline in outstanding ad hoc services. Revenue from contracted termite control services will increase threefold that of ad hoc services by 2027. The rapid increase in contracted services is aided by the fact that stringent legal requirements are requiring key industries, including food and beverages, to enter into pest control contracts, apropos product hygiene.

According to a new Fact.MR study, the market for termite control services remains marginally concentrated and marginally fragmented. Emerging gamers, which include a cohort of local termite control service providers, continue to track bulk revenue shares, while Tier 1 players collectively account for nearly a quarter of revenue shares. Emerging companies like Massey Services Inc. and Porch.com Inc. continue to focus in the termite control services market on providing specific service offerings and competitive pricing to drive revenue. On the other hand, the focus of Tier 1 players like Rentokil Initial Plc and Rollins Inc. continues to focus on market consolidation through the acquisition of local players.

“Competitors in the termite control services market include providers for a range of industry applications ranging from facility services to lawn care. Large multidisciplinary companies in the termite control services market offer termite control as part of their service portfolio, attracting commercial customers who prefer contractual services. In addition, key customers, especially residential customers, are more likely to do-it-yourself termite control (DIY) to save on spending, even though they lack access to commercial strength pesticides and have less technical expertise. This remains a major growth deterrent for the termite control services market, ”says a senior analyst at Fact.MR.

Leading companies in the termite control services market also invest heavily in information systems and technology to support day-to-day operations. Termite control service entrants investing in programs to automate payables, accounts receivable, billing, and invoicing are likely to offer more effective services and see promising growth in the years to come. The major players in the Termite Control Services market are focused on the introduction of handheld devices and software programs to manage routing and scheduling to optimize technician productivity.

An important trend in the termite control services market is the increasing penetration of insurance-based services to avoid cost risks, especially for commercial customers. Significant investments include termite control services for commercial and industrial end users as standard insurance policies do not include destruction costs. The proliferation of such specialized insurance policies will likely allow customers to control their spending while having access to reliable termite control service providers.
